Fire risk assessments have been completed for all the blocks at Brock End. These confirm the “Stay Put” policies for the modern blocks and the “Leave” policy for the two older blocks at Betjeman House and Vilett House. The risk assessment confirmed that fire alarm systems are not necessary in the modern blocks but should be retained in the older blocks with a “leave” policy in place.
